Climate change, species extinctions and tipping points

Researchers from North Carolina State University have created a model that mimics how differently adapted populations may respond to rapid climate change. Their findings demonstrate that depending on a population's adaptive strategy, even tiny changes in climate variability can create a "tipping point" that sends the population into extinction.

Carlos Botero, postdoctoral fellow with the Initiative on Biological Complexity and the Southeast Climate Science Center at NC State and assistant professor of biology at Washington State University, wanted to find out how diverse populations of organisms might cope with quickly changing, less predictable climate variations.

Hope for the Monarch Butterfly

When millions of monarch butterflies take to the sky and fly thousands of kilometres from the United States and southern Canada to Mexico, the view is breathtaking. But over the last few decades, their numbers have plummeted, and last year hit an all-time low. Illegal logging in Mexican forests, where the monarchs hibernate during winter, has traditionally been to blame. But large-scale logging by companies appears to have been halted. And now small-scale logging by local people for firewood and timber — a “growing concern in 2013” — has also stopped, according to a study published last month (27 October) in Biological Conservation.

World Bank warns effects of warming climate now unavoidable

As the planet continues to warm, heat-waves and other extreme weather events that today occur once in hundreds of years, if ever, will become the “new climate normal,” creating a world of increased risks and instability, a new World Bank study warns. 

The consequences for development would be severe as crop yields decline, water resources shift, sea-levels rise, and the livelihoods of millions of people are put at risk, according to a new scientific report released today by the World Bank Group.

Can Volcanic Eruptions Slow Global Warming?

Small volcanic eruptions might eject more of an atmosphere-cooling gas into Earth’s upper atmosphere than previously thought, potentially contributing to the recent slowdown in global warming, according to a new study.

Not so fast: Planting trees might cause warming?

Afforestation (planting trees) to mitigate climate change could cause warming rather than cooling globally due to non-carbon effects of land use change, according to new research from the University of Bristol.

Global land use change and its interaction with the climate system is recognised as an important component of the Intergovernmental Panel on Climate Change (IPCC)’s future climate scenarios.

Abrupt rise in greenhouse gases at end of last ice age may be because of permafrost

One of the most abrupt rises in the carbon dioxide concentration in the atmosphere at the end of the last ice age took place about 14,600 years ago. Ice core data show that the CO2 concentration at that time increased by more than 10 ppm (parts per million, unit of measure for the composition of gases) within 200 years. This CO2 increase, i.e. approx. 0.05 ppm per year, was significantly less than the current rise in atmospheric CO2 of 2-3 ppm in the last decade caused by fossil fuels.

UK unveils first waste-fueled bus

The UK's first ever bus powered on human and food waste has taken to the road today which engineers believe could provide a sustainable way of fuelling public transport - cutting emissions in polluted towns and cities. The 40-seater Bio-Bus, which runs on gas generated through the treatment of sewage and food waste that's unfit for human consumption, helps to improve urban air quality as it produces fewer emissions than traditional diesel engines. Running on waste products that are both renewable and sustainable, the bus can travel up to 300km on a full tank of gas.
